Unnamed (Hydrous Magnesium Aluminosilicate; 23Å Phase)
A material that is NOT an approved mineral species
This page is currently not sponsored. Click here to sponsor this page.
Formula:
Mg11Al2Si4O16(OH)12
Specific Gravity:
2.761 (Calculated)
Crystal System:
Hexagonal
A hypothetical, synthesized phase that is expected to be present in Al-bearing subducting slabs, thus transferring water and Al into either upper deep mantle or upper part of the transition zone.
Structurally unique among chemically similar compounds in having a very long c axis.
Stability in the same range as of the Phase A. Also stable "in the chlorite composition", at 10 GPa and 1000 °C.

Crystallography of Unnamed (Hydrous Magnesium Aluminosilicate; 23Å Phase)
Crystal System:
Hexagonal
Cell Parameters:
a = 5.1972(2) Å, c = 22.991(4) Å
Ratio:
a:c = 1 : 4.424
Unit Cell V:
537.8 ų
Z:
1
Comment:
Space group is P6c2, P63cm, or P63/mcm
